Your Brain on Food: How Chemicals Control Your Thoughts and Feelings
Why is eating chocolate so pleasurable? Can the function of just one small group of chemicals really determine whether you are happy or sad? Is it really best to drink coffee if you want to wake up and be alert?
In this book, Gary Wenk demonstrates how, as a result of their effects on certain neurotransmitters concerned with behavior, everything we put into our bodies has very direct consequences for how we think, feel, and act.

This book is an interdisciplinary review of the effect of fracture on life, following the development of the understanding of fracture written from a historical perspective. After a short introduction to fracture, the first section of the book covers the effects of fracture on the evolution of the Earth, plants and animals, and man. The second section of the book covers the largely empirical control of fracture from ancient times to the end of the nineteenth century.
